The product of multiplying an integer by itself is the square of a number. Square is used in programming, calculating areas, and so on. In the topic, we will discuss the square of 413.
The square of a number is the product of the number itself.
The square of 413 is 413 × 413.

The square of 413 is 413 × 413 = 170,569.
Square of 413 in exponential form: 413²
Square of 413 in arithmetic form: 413 × 413
The square of a number is multiplying the number by itself. So let’s learn how to find the square of a number. These are the common methods used to find the square of a number.
In this method, we will multiply the number by itself to find the square. The product here is the square of the number. Let’s find the square of 413.
Step 1: Identify the number. Here, the number is 413.
Step 2: Multiplying the number by itself, we get, 413 × 413 = 170,569.
The square of 413 is 170,569.
In this method, the formula, a² is used to find the square of the number. Where a is the number.
Step 1: Understanding the equation Square of a number = a² a² = a × a
Step 2: Identifying the number and substituting the value in the equation.
Here, ‘a’ is 413.
So: 413² = 413 × 413 = 170,569

Sarah is planning to decorate her square garden of length 413 feet. The cost to decorate a square foot is 5 dollars. Then how much will it cost to decorate the full garden?
The length of the garden = 413 feet The cost to decorate 1 square foot of garden = 5 dollars. To find the total cost to decorate, we find the area of the garden, Area of the garden = area of the square = a² Here a = 413 Therefore, the area of the garden = 413² = 413 × 413 = 170,569. The cost to decorate the garden = 170,569 × 5 = 852,845. The total cost = 852,845 dollars
To find the cost to decorate the garden, we multiply the area of the garden by the cost to decorate per foot.
So, the total cost is 852,845 dollars.
